Literacy Support Services (NOGALSS), a non-governmental organisation, is set to honour former President Goodluck Ebele Jonathan, Speaker of the House of Representatives, Hon. Femi Gbajabiamila as well as Governor Nyesom Wike of Rivers State with the Hall of Fame Award, 2022 edition.
The Public Relations Officer of NOGALSS, Ambsassador Idris A. Musa, in a statement said: “In recognition of their commitments and concern toward solving the challenges of mass illiteracy in their respective leadership capacities, former Nigerian president Dr. Goodluck Ebele Jonathan, Speaker, House of Representatives, Hon. Femi Gbajabiamila, as well as the Rivers State Governor Nyesom Ezenwo Wike, have been selected for the NOGALSS Hall of Fame Awards 2022.
“Also to be recognized with awards are the Governor of Borno State, Prof. Babagana Umara Zulum, his Kano State counterpart, Dr Abdullahi Umar Ganduje, and Alhaji Muhammad Inuwa Yahaya, the Gombe State governor.”
The statement added that the event is scheduled for mid-December in Abuja, noting that former governors of Imo and Zamfara States, Owelle Rochas Anayo Okorocha, and Alhaji Mahmud Aliyu Shinkafi also made the list of personalities to be honoured.
